If the Borrower for any reason (including, without --------------- limitation, pursuant to the last sentence of Section 2.8(a) and Section 8.2 hereof) makes any payment of principal with respect to any LIBOR Loan on any day other than the last day of an Interest Period applicable to such LIBOR Loan, or fails to borrow or continue or convert to a LIBOR Loan after giving a Notice of Borrowing or Conversion thereof pursuant to Section 2.5 and in reliance on such notice the Lender has made such LIBOR Loan (of if such LIBOR Loan has not yet been made, the Lender has obtained or committed to obtain matched funding for such LIBOR Loan), or fails to prepay a LIBOR Loan after having given notice thereof as provided in Section 2.8(a), the Borrower shall pay to the Lender an amount computed pursuant to the following formula: L = (R - T) x P x D --------------- 360 L = amount payable to the Lender R = interest rate on such LIBOR Loan T = effective interest rate per annum at which any readily marketable bond or other obligation of the United States, selected at SSB's reasonable discretion, maturing on or near the last day of the then applicable Interest Period of such LIBOR Loan and in approximately the same amount as such Loan can be purchased by SSB on the day of such payment of principal or failure to borrow, continue, convert or prepay P = the amount of principal prepaid or the amount of the requested Loan or the amount of the prepayment not made D = the number of days remaining in the Interest Period as of the date of such payment or failure or the number of days of the requested Fixed Rate Period The Borrower shall pay such amount upon presentation by the Lender of a statement setting forth the amount and the Lender's calculation thereof pursuant hereto, which statement shall be deemed true and correct absent manifest error. 2.11 Fixed Rate Indemnity. If the Borrower for any reason (including, -------------------- without limitation, pursuant to the last sentence of Section 2.8(c) and Section 8.2 hereof) makes any prepayment of principal with respect to any Fixed Rate Loan, the Borrower shall pay to the Lender an amount computed pursuant to the following formula: L = (R - T) x P x D --------------- 360 L = amount payable to the Lender R = interest rate on such Fixed Rate Loan T = effective interest rate per annum at which any readily marketable bond or other obligation of the United States, selected at SSB's reasonable discretion, maturing on or near the last day of the then applicable Fixed Rate Period of such Fixed Rate Loan and in approximately the same amount as such Loan can be purchased by SSB on the day of such payment of principal P = the amount of principal prepaid D = the number of days remaining in the Fixed Rate Period as of the date of such payment The Borrower shall pay such amount upon presentation by the Lender of a statement setting forth the amount and the Lender's calculation thereof pursuant hereto, which statement shall be deemed -17- true and correct absent manifest error. If at the time of prepayment of any Fixed Rate Loan there are more than six months remaining in the Fixed Rate Period of such Loan, the amount payable by the Borrower pursuant to this Section 2.11 shall equal the amount determined pursuant to the formula set forth above, discounted to present value, as calculated by the Lender using a discount rate equal to Lender's cost of funds rate used to determine the Fixed Rate of the Fixed Rate Loan being prepaid. 2.12 Computation of Interest and Fees. SECTION VI ---------- FINANCIAL COVENANTS ------------------- The Borrower covenants that so long as any Loan, Letter of Credit or other Obligation remains outstanding or the Lender has any obligation to make any Loan or issue any Letter of Credit hereunder: 6.1 Profitability. The Borrower shall not permit Consolidated Net Income ------------- (excluding non-cash compensation expense) to be less than zero in any two consecutive fiscal quarters (taken as separate periods and determined at the end of each fiscal quarter for the fiscal quarter then ending). In addition, Consolidated Net Income (excluding non-cash compensation expense) for any four consecutive fiscal quarters (taken as a single period and determined at the end of each fiscal quarter for the four fiscal quarters then ending) shall not be less than the following amounts for the following periods: Twelve Months Ending Minimum Net Income -------------------- ------------------ December 31, 1996 $ 1 March 31, 1997, June 30, 1997 and September 30, 1997 $ 500,000 December 31, 1997 and the last day of each fiscal quarter thereafter $2,000,000 6.2 Tangible Net Worth. The Borrower shall at the end of each fiscal ------------------ quarter maintain a Consolidated Tangible Net Worth of not less than, (a) for the fiscal quarter ending December 31, 1996, an amount equal to the greater of $10,000,000 or 85% of the Borrower's Consolidated -32- Tangible Net Worth at December 31, 1996 and (b) for each fiscal quarter thereafter, an amount equal to (i) the amount of Tangible Net Worth required to be maintained at the end of the immediately preceding fiscal quarter, plus (ii) fifty percent (50%) of Consolidated Net Income for the most recently ended fiscal quarter. 6.3 Debt to Worth Ratio. The ratio of Consolidated Total Liabilities to ------------------- Consolidated Tangible Net Worth shall not exceed 4.0 to 1.0 at the end of the fiscal quarter ending December 31, 1996 and the end of each fiscal quarter thereafter. 6.4 Debt Service Coverage. The ratio of EBITDA (less Unfinanced Capital --------------------- Expenditures and dividends to the extent payment of such dividends is permitted under Section 7.5) to Total Debt Service shall not be less than 1.5 to 1.0 at the end of each fiscal quarter for the four fiscal quarters then ended.
